Automatic doors London are a great addition to any home, providing both convenience and security. They can open and close with the push of a button, making it easy for anyone to enter or exit your home, even if they have limited mobility.

However, there are a few things to keep in mind before you install automatic store doors in your home. First, they can be expensive, so be sure to do your research and compare prices from different companies before making a purchase. Additionally, automatic doors require electricity to operate, so you’ll need to have a reliable power source nearby. Finally, keep in mind that these doors can be a potential safety hazard for small children or pets if not installed properly.

What are the different types of automatic doors?

There are many different types of automatic doors, including:

1. Sliding doors: Automatic Sliding doors open and close by sliding across a track. They are typically used for exterior doors.

2. Pocket doors: Pocket doors open and close by disappearing into a pocket in the wall. They are commonly used for interior doors.

3. swing doors: Swing doors open and close like traditional doors, but they have an automated mechanism that opens and closes them.

4. Folding doors: Folding doors open and close by folding up or down, like an accordion. They are typically used for exterior doors.

The most common type of automatic door system is the one that uses infrared sensors. These are installed above the door and detect when someone is approaching. They will then open the door automatically. Another type of system is the pressure-sensitive mat. These are placed in front of the door and when someone steps on them, it will trigger the door to open. 

There is also some automatic door system that is voice-activated. These work by detecting the sound of someone’s voice and then opening the door.

Different types of control panels (Radio or Infrared)

There are two main types of automatic door control panels: radio and infrared. Radio control panels use a wireless transmitter to send signals to the door opener, while infrared models use a beam of light to communicate with the opener. Both types have their own advantages and disadvantages that you should consider before choosing one for your home.

Radio control panels are more expensive than their infrared counterparts, but they offer a few key advantages. Radio doors can be programmed to open and close at specific times, which is ideal if you want to automate your doors for security purposes. Additionally, radio doors are less likely to be disrupted by outside interference, making them more reliable overall.

Infrared control panels are less expensive than radio models, but they have a few drawbacks as well. Infrared doors can be disrupted by bright sunlight or other strong light sources, so they may not work as well in sunny climates. Additionally, because they rely on line-of-sight communication, infrared doors can only be used with closes that are within range of the panel – typically about 30 feet.

How to install a Tilt Sensor

If you have an automatic door system in your home, chances are you have a tilt sensor installed as well. A tilt sensor is a device that detects the tilting of an object and triggers an alarm. They are often used in security systems to prevent burglary or theft. Here is a step-by-step guide on how to install a tilt sensor:

1. Choose the location for the sensor. It is important to place the sensor in an area where it will not be disturbed by normal household activities. A good location for the sensor is on the frame of a door or window.

2. Drill a hole for the wires. The size of the hole will depend on the size of the wires coming from the sensor.

3. Feed the wires through the hole and connect them to the terminals on the back of the sensor. Make sure that all connections are secure and tight.

4. Test the sensor by opening and closing the door or window it is attached to. The alarm should sound when the door or window opened beyond a certain point.

How to install remote controls

Assuming you have already purchased your remote controls, the following is a guide on how to install them.

1. Mount the control box onto a wall near the door using screws and wall plugs. Make sure it is at a comfortable height for you to reach.

2. Connect the power supply to the control box.

3. Take the receiver unit and adhere it to the inside of the door using double-sided tape or screws (depending on what type of receiver unit you have).

4. Place batteries into each remote control.

5. Press the “learn” button on the control box, then press and hold the button on each remote until the LED light on the control box flashes (this can take up to 30 seconds). You should now be able to operate your door with your remote controls!

Retrofitting an Existing Door System to be an Automatic Door System

Adding an automatic door system to an existing door can be a great way to increase the value of your home while improving its accessibility. If you are considering retrofitting an existing door system to be an automatic door system, there are a few things you should keep in mind.

First, you will need to make sure that the existing door system is compatible with the automatic door opener. Some older doors may not be compatible with newer models of automatic door openers. In addition, you will need to make sure that the new opener is properly installed and calibrated.

Second, you will need to consider the power requirements of the new opener. Most automatic door openers require a 120-volt power source. If your home does not have a 120-volt outlet near the door, you may need to hire an electrician to install one.

Third, you will need to take into account any other changes that will be required for the installation of the new opener. For example, if your existing door has glass panels, you may need to replace them with solid panels in order for the opener to work properly.

Fourth, you should consult with a professional installer before proceeding with the installation. This will ensure that everything is done correctly and that your warranty remains intact.
